Skip to content

Conversation

@MikyungKim
Copy link
Contributor

@MikyungKim MikyungKim commented Apr 7, 2022

In this PR, we'd like to fix screenshot test build fail from sandstone.
With Webpack5, automatic Node.js polyfils are removed. (https://webpack.js.org/blog/2020-10-10-webpack-5-release/#automatic-nodejs-polyfills-removed)
But we need some modules from ui-test-utils to run screenshot tests.
So, I've added node-polyfill-webpack-plugin to resolve those modules.
Also, fixed lint error.

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])
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])
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])
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])
@MikyungKim MikyungKim changed the title WRN-20481: Fix screenshot test build failed WRN-20481: Fix screenshot test build fail Apr 7, 2022
Copy link
Contributor

@hong6316 hong6316 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Test result checked(#872~#873)

LGTM

@hong6316 hong6316 merged commit 9fa7858 into feature/webpack5 Apr 7, 2022
@hong6316 hong6316 deleted the feature/WRN-20481 branch April 7, 2022 07:19
hong6316 added a commit that referenced this pull request Apr 11, 2022
* WRN-18582: Migrate to webpack5 (#264)

* WRN-18582: webpack5 initial commit

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* WRN-18582: Fixed serve issue

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* WRN-18582: Added webpack cache config

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* applied more changes

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* Added changelog

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* fix

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* update `listen` to `startCallback` from webpack dev server

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* fix filename..ext issue

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* WRN-16762: Added support for tailwindcss and update dependencies (#263)

* initial modules update(before wp5 update)

* npm audit fix

* Update package.json

* fix lint errors

* update CHANGELOG.md

* Update package.json

* revert CHANGELOG.mx

* revert jest 27

* revert npm-shrinkwrap.json

* revert pack/serve.js

* for removing conflict with #262, revert versions

* Update react-refresh-webpack-plugin version

Co-authored-by: Mikyung Kim <[email protected]>

* Update babel-jest version

Co-authored-by: Mikyung Kim <[email protected]>

* Update babel-plugin-dev-expression version

Co-authored-by: Mikyung Kim <[email protected]>

* remove unnecessary code

* revert file permission

* update dependencies

* update package.json

* Update package.json

Co-authored-by: Mikyung Kim <[email protected]>

* Update package.json

* fix

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

Co-authored-by: Mikyung Kim <[email protected]>

* update changelog and package.json

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

Co-authored-by: taeyoung.hong <[email protected]>

* WRN-12124: Remove deprecated babel-eslint module (#261)

* use @babel/eslint-parser

* remove babel-preset-react-app

* remove @babel/eslint-parser

* Revert "remove @babel/eslint-parser"

This reverts commit 1b8b37e.

* Revert "remove babel-preset-react-app"

This reverts commit b8579cb.

* Revert "use @babel/eslint-parser"

This reverts commit b73146a.

* babel-eslint -> @babel/eslint-parser

* unpinning enact repos

* remove babel-eslint related word in README.md

* Update README.md

* modify changelog & readme

* Update package.json

Co-authored-by: Mikyung Kim <[email protected]>

* Update README.md

Co-authored-by: Mikyung Kim <[email protected]>

* update npm-shrinkwrap.json

* update @babel/core to the same version of dev-utils

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* Move some dependencies to dev dependencies

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

Co-authored-by: Mikyung Kim <[email protected]>

* WRN-19252: Pass ProgressPlugin to VerboseLogPlugin (#265)

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* WRN-12748: Update eslint 8 related modules (#262)

* update eslint 8

* eslint 8 changes strict package exports(#14706), call another method

* revert js changes

* Update package.json

* restore eslintrc.js - 'prettier' (included 'prettier/babel', 'prettier/react')

* Update package.json

Co-authored-by: Mikyung Kim <[email protected]>

Co-authored-by: Mikyung Kim <[email protected]>

* WRN-19694: Update to React18 (#266)

* update react version

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* update testing library for react18

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* update react version

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* update dependencies

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* update version

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* update dev-utils branch

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* revert dev-utils version

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* WRN-20481: Fix screenshot test build fail (#267)

* Added node-polyfill-webpack-plugin

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* added some comments

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* link dev-utils

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* WRN-20481: Fix lint error and revert packages version

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* update change log

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

* update dependencies

Enact-DCO-1.0-Signed-off-by: Mikyung Kim ([email protected])

Co-authored-by: taeyoung.hong <[email protected]>
hong6316 added a commit that referenced this pull request Sep 4,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ants